Sawa / Sofia Tomamnak, wife of Rufus Aose, reacts angrily as she does not get a share of the government subsidy money (Dana Respek), where thousands of dollars
equivalent of rupiah in cash are distributed among members of the villages. The corruption of such subsidised money lead to frequent outrage amongst the people demanding equal distribution. The Dana Respek money, administered by the Indonesian government, were intentionally used for development projects in the province of Papua. However, abuse of the money by the distributor renders the people never having received appropriate shares of the money. The distributors, sometimes Asmat people themselves, naturally will give larger share to their next of kin.
